Overview

Postcode S71 4EH is located in a minor urban area, within the Royston ward of Barnsley in the Yorkshire and The Humber region, and forms part of the Royston West area. It has average deprivation and low crime levels, with around 41.3 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 63% below the Yorkshire and The Humber average of 113 per 1,000. The average income per household in Royston West is £45,042 per year. The nearest station is Darton, about 3.3 miles away. There are 4 primary and no sec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est large park is Royston Park.
